From what I have seen the third disk has mostly server type apps. So if you installed just a work station you don't really need it. If you installed a web server then you would proably need disc three. Most of the time when I install a machine at work I only need a package or two of the third cd.

To change your video setting try using redhat-config-xfree86 which comes with redhat 9 and maybe 8. If you want help with stuff you need to tell us the version your running and what kind of hardware you have like what kind of sound card you have.
